What happened when Jesus healed the leper?

The leper showed great faith in Jesus’ ability to heal him. He said, “Sir, if you want to you can make me clean.” After Jesus healed the leper, he gave him strict instructions to show himself to the priest to be examined and declared clean again, and not to tell anyone about the miracle.

What happened to the four lepers in the Bible?

In the book of 2 Kings chapter 7 we see the story of four leprous men that stayed at the entrance of the city gate during a famine in Samaria. Leprosy in scripture meant those who had it were unclean and were outcasts from society. … In all of this turmoil, these lepers stayed at the gate.

How was leprosy cured?

How is leprosy cured? Antibiotics can cure leprosy. They work by killing the bacteria that cause leprosy. While antibiotics can kill the bacteria, they cannot reverse damage caused by the bacteria.

What causes leprosy and is there a cure?

Hansen’s disease (also known as leprosy) is an infection caused by slow-growing bacteria called Mycobacterium leprae. It can affect the nerves, skin, eyes, and lining of the nose (nasal mucosa). With early diagnosis and treatment, the disease can be cured.
